Embracing the Freeform Style

Freehand Brushstrokes:

Let your brush dance freely over your nails, creating spontaneous and organic forms. Experiment with different brush widths and textures to create a unique and expressive design.

Sponge Dabbing:

Dip a makeup sponge into various shades of brown and gently dab it onto your nails. This technique will give you a soft, diffused effect with beautiful color blending.

Foil Transfers:

Create abstract patterns by crumpling aluminum foil and pressing it onto your polish. Remove the foil to reveal a captivating and unpredictable design.

Geometric Precision

Negative Space Designs:

Combine brown and negative space to create a modern and minimalist look. Leave certain areas of your nails unpainted, allowing the natural nail color to peek through.

Asymmetrical Shapes:

Play with asymmetrical shapes and angles to achieve a bold and graphic effect. Use different shades of brown to create a sense of depth and dimension.

Color Blocking:

Experiment with color blocking by creating geometric sections of different brown shades. This technique will give your nails a clean and contemporary look.

Textures and Finishes

Textured Polish:

Add depth and interest to your nail design by using textured polish. Look for polishes with shimmer, glitter, or a matte finish to create a unique tactile experience.

Swirls and Marbling:

Create mesmerizing swirls and marbling effects by mixing different shades of brown polish and swirling them together. Use a toothpick or a small brush for greater control.

How do I create brown abstract nail designs at home?

  • Use a dotting tool or toothpick to create dots and lines.
  • Experiment with different nail polish brushes to achieve different textures.
  • Use tape or stickers to create negative space or geometric shapes.
  • Layer different shades of brown and allow them to blend.
  • Top off with a clear top coat to seal the design.

What tools do I need to create brown abstract nail designs?

  • Nail polish in various shades of brown
  • Nail polish brush set
  • Dotting tool or toothpick
  • Tape or stickers (optional)
  • Clear top coat

How long do brown abstract nail designs last?

The longevity of your abstract nail designs depends on factors such as the quality of the nail polish, your nail preparation, and how well you care for them. With proper care, they can last up to 7-10 days.

Can I use any type of nail polish for abstract designs?

Yes, you can use any type of nail polish, including regular, gel, or dip powder. However, some polishes may be more opaque or have a faster drying time, which can affect the final result.

What are some tips for creating flawless abstract nail designs?

  • Start with a clean and prepped nail base.
  • Use a thin layer of nail polish to prevent it from becoming too thick or clumpy.
  • Allow each layer to dry completely before adding the next.
  • Practice on a piece of paper or a spare nail tip to get the hang of the techniques.

Can I incorporate different colors into my brown abstract designs?

Yes, you can incorporate other colors into your brown abstract designs to create a more vibrant or cohesive look. Experiment with different color combinations and shades to find what works best for you.

How do I fix smudged or messy abstract nail designs?

If your abstract design smudges or gets messy, you can use a cleanup brush dipped in nail polish remover to gently remove excess polish. Allow the remaining design to dry completely before reapplying top coat.
